Oil painting titled Galanterie Andalouse (Palette Peinte) by Luis Menéndez Pidal (1864–1932), dated 1888, Spain, 31 × 22 cm, signed, in the nineteenth‑century classical style.

- Oil on palette. Signed and dated.

- In an idealized Seville like that of Rossini's Barber or Mozart's Don Giovanni, an aristocrat surrounded by his inevitable coterie of servants and flatterers praises the beauty of two passersby dressed in the Goyaesque fashion, who laugh at the count's compliments, engaging in a roguish exchange of flirtatious banter and confidences with the opposite sex, gathered at the threshold of the centuries-old palace.

Luis Menéndez Pidal was a notable Spanish painter and decorator. He was a professor at the Madrid School of Industrial Arts and the School of Arts and Crafts, a professor of antique drawing and drapery at the Madrid School of Fine Arts, and a corresponding member of the Royal Academy of Fine Arts of San Fernando. After completing his law studies, he entered the Madrid School of Painting, where he became a student of Alejandro Ferrant. In 1886, thanks to a scholarship, he moved to Rome to further his training. There he studied under Francisco Pradilla and José Villegas. He traveled to Naples, Venice, and Florence, where he attended the Accademia Nazionale Ussi. He collaborated on the decoration of the Church of San Francisco el Grande in Madrid, painting the dome of one of the chapels. He participated in numerous exhibitions, both individual and collective, obtaining a second medal at the National Fine Arts Exhibition of 1890, two first medals in 1892 and 1899, for the canvases entitled The Empty Cradle and Salus Infirmorum, decoration in 1895 and medal of honor in 1924. In addition, he was awarded a gold medal at the International Exhibition of Munich in 1900.
